Frost is going to be in a tough spot. He has an undefeated season to achieve, a conference championship game to prepare and coach in in a few days, yet he has the fate of two programs waiting on his decision. Two programs that I am sure Frost has the utmost respect for.
If he chooses Nebraska, you'd think he would want to let UCF know as soon as possible so they could get started on their coaching search to replace him.
If he chooses UCF, you'd think he would let Nebraska know so they could get started on moving on to other options.
With all the coaching moves being decided at a super fast pace right now, all the available coaches are getting hired and it will be slim pickings in a week. This early signing period has really changed the game.
So be it Nebraska or UCF, one of these programs needs an answer to get started on their future.
